William Garrott Brown (1868-1913) was a historian and essayist best known for his essay collection titled The Lower South in American History, and also for his short biographies of Stephen Douglas and Andrew Jackson. Born the youngest of eight children in Alabama in 1868, Brown entered Harvard University in 1889 and received a master”s degree in history in 1892. While serving as Deputy Keeper of University Records and as a lecturer in the History Department, Brown produced seven books from 1900-1905. Plagued by ill health, he died of complications from tuberculosis in 1913.
